The Albéniz Foundation is a leading cultural institution in Europe. It manages one of Europe’s most important educational and musical initiatives: the Reina Sofía School of Music. We believe we have a fundamental role to play not only in educating the most talented young musicians, but also in bringing music closer to people and promoting culture. The institution is currently experiencing significant growth, with the expansion project into a new building provided by the Ministry of Culture, the internationalisation of our activity and funding sources, and the development of new programmes that increase the impact of our work and diversify funding sources, ensuring the Foundation’s long-term sustainability.
The Albéniz Foundation has a unique public-private funding model in Spain, with more than 100 patrons and sponsors, including the most relevant companies in sectors such as finance, technology, and energy, nationally and internationally. Sponsors’ contributions amount to more than €4.8 million per year. In addition, the Foundation is committed to innovation and digitalisation and is a pioneer in leading European projects.
